In your job you will work for the offshore energy division. Boskalis has one of the largest global fleets of specialized offshore vessels, allowing us to carry out a broad range of offshore activities. We provide innovative and sustainable all-round solutions to tackle major worldwide maritime challenges. Our Offshore Energy division supports sustainable energy solutions such as wind energy as well as traditional fossil facilities. We’re involved in the entire journey from developing and transporting to maintaining and decommissioning these facilities.
Job Description
Are you ready for your next step within Boskalis? The Fleet Management department within the Boskalis Offshore Energy division is offering a job opportunity as hr business partner marine crew.
The role of HR is relatively new within Fleet Management and our main focus is to give more attention and focus to our marine crew. We want to add a more long-term view and perspective on development and succession planning of the colleagues on board. Working in close cooperation with sourcing & crew management who are highly skilled in finding talent, planning, rostering and compliance. The role of hr business partner is relatively new within our team and further development and optimization of the organization and our processes are on our agenda. You will play an important role in realizing HR projects as part of this initiative so we are looking for a solid hr business partner with affinity for projects.
Throughout the work as a hr business partner it is key to execute your work based on the Human Excellence pillars ‘Performance & Development, Diversity & Inclusion, Mobility and Vitality’. In this role close collaboration with your colleagues of Crewing Fleet Management is key. You will be working with a team of international crew that work on our vessels all over the world. You are responsible for executing and monitoring HR policies for our Crew department and you will be challenged to continuously improve the policies we have in place. You are result-oriented and enjoy working in an international and dynamic environment. You are proactive and, based on your knowledge and experience, you initiate and organize.
Your responsibilities as HR Business Partner Marine Crew:
- In this role, you immediately become the advisor, sounding board and coach for our crewing department and vessels. You are a true business partner and do not shy away from handling operational matters as they arise.
- You will follow up to HR related topics of appraisal reviews and coaching on crew employees in their career with Boskalis.
- You provide solicited and unsolicited advice and feedback to the crew coordinators and vessels which are assigned to you on HR topics, such as performance management, talent management, succession planning and employment conditions.
- You are involved in various HR projects (in line with the Human Excellence pillars) to create the basis of Human Excellence within marine crew of OE Fleet Management such as optimizing performance management and projects related to our wide variety of employment packages.
- You guide and support the managers and crewing department with further implementation of key HR processes like talent development, recruitment activities and performance action plans.
